- [ ] **Locker access flow review.** Before we ship the new Tumblebin pickup flow, double-check that the one-time door codes actually expire after a single open — last cycle they lingered for ten minutes. Also confirm the audit log captures failed attempts. Sign off here once you've poked at it on the staging kiosk. The candidate build's token follows.

pipeline stamp: htk9_ce63042d9

Subject: ScanBridge cut-over done

Cut-over to ScanBridge v4 finished at 02:10. All Velk warehouse scanners now route through the new decoder. Old endpoint stays up read-only until Friday, then Priya kills it. Two misreads during the window, both retried clean. Pager rotation unchanged. If the decoder hiccups, restart the pod before escalating. Current production configuration follows below.

settings of kajog-bajof:
[fraion]
host = fraion.orvexworks.internal
user = fraion_svc
database = fraion_prod

Q: Why did the Cartwheel driver-assignment heuristic change in release 14?

A: The old nearest-idle rule starved suburban zones. Release 14 weights proximity against queue age, capped at four-minute wait. No config changes needed; rollback flag is driver_assign_v13. Verification requires the staging dispatch console, which unlocks with the passphrase directly below.

vault phrase of bagaf-kajeg = jorath-feniel-briir-siliel-ralix

# Break-Glass: Catalog Cache Invalidation

Scope: the Pinrow product catalog at Veldstone Retail. If stale prices persist after a purge and the Hollowmere invalidation queue is wedged, use break-glass to flush the edge tier directly. Contractors: get verbal sign-off from the catalog lead first. Steps: open the Hollowmere admin shell, select emergency-flush, confirm the tenant, and run it once — repeated flushes thrash the origin. Access is logged and expires after 20 minutes. Unseal the admin shell with the passphrase below.

recovery phrase for kahop-tajog: istix-casvan